What Uses Are There for Mild
Steel Flat Bars?
There are numerous beneficial
uses for both ordinary mild steel and bright mild steel. Apart from its
widespread application in the production of cables and automotive parts, it is
also utilized in the fabrication of smaller products such as screw fasteners

The preferred material for
engineering is bright mild steel. Because it responds to internal strain, it is
frequently utilized in applications with modest stress levels. This is due to
the fact that it is both hard and strong. Bright mild steel is frequently used
as a generic material while constructing bolts, axles, and other types of
machinery.
Flat bar is frequently used in a
wide variety of frames and plates because to its adaptability and simplicity in
cutting and welding. Although they need to be treated to prevent corrosion,
their extensive use in the construction sector is also feasible.

Advantages of Using Bright
Mild Steel
Steel's high carbon content makes
it extremely strong in all forms, but the higher the carbon content, the more
difficult it is to work with and shape. Steel that has a lower carbon content
is more flexible and hence easier to deal with. Despite being less expensive,
lower carbon steels are not as durable as their higher carbon equivalents.
Cold rolling increases the
tensile strength of mild steel by applying more pressure to the material.
Furthermore, bright mild steel is more resilient to pressure and strain than
ordinary mild steel.
Furthermore, compared to mild
steel, bright mild steel is more refined and has a better finish. During the
hot rolling operation, the metal's recrystallization temperature is surpassed.
As a result, the metal may exhibit flaws and thickness differences as it cools
and contracts. Furthermore, the proportions may be somewhat incorrect.
